How Impact Health Sharing Works: A Comprehensive Guide

In today's world, healthcare costs are skyrocketing, leaving many individuals and families struggling to make ends meet. Impact Health Sharing is a non-profit, non-insurance alternative that offers a unique solution to the high cost of health insurance. Through a community-based approach, Impact Health Sharing members share and pay each other's medical bills, providing a more affordable and accessible way to cover healthcare expenses.

How Impact Health Sharing Works

When you become a member of Impact Health Sharing, you'll first activate your Impact Share account. This account is used to manage all sharing activities. Once a month, members deposit a specified amount into their account, known as their monthly share. Share dollars are then matched and allocated to another member who has an eligible medical bill that needs to be paid.

Sharing Medical Bills

Once your monthly share amount has been matched to a member, Impact will notify you as to whom you have been matched with and how much of your funds they'll receive. This process is called publishing. Once notified, funds are transferred from your share account into their share account. When the member has received the full amount needed to pay that medical bill, it is then sent electronically to the medical provider and paid in full.

Primary Responsibility Amount (PRA)

The Primary Responsibility Amount (PRA) is the annual amount that every member household is responsible for paying before any of their eligible medical bills can be published to the members for sharing. Impact offers four PRA options to choose from, allowing members to select the option that best fits their budget and needs.

Co-share

The co-share is the percentage of an eligible medical bill paid by the member after the PRA has been met. As an Impact member, once your PRA has been met, you pay 10% of all eligible medical bills. The remaining 90% is published for sharing to the Impact membership. However, the total co-share amount, which you are responsible for, is limited to five thousand dollars annually per household.

Distributed or Decentralized Reserving

In order to process and pay medical bills quickly, Impact Health Sharing implements a practice called distributed or decentralized reserving. Impact is not insurance and does not collect and hold medical reserves in a centralized bank account. Instead, the monthly share amount is set at a level to build a small balance or reserve in each member's individual share account. These distributed reserves enable Impact Health Sharing to better manage the fluctuation of medical usage and payments.
